How to Make One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ner

  1. Rinse chickpeas: Drain and rinse the canned chickpeas under cold water to remove excess sodium. This step helps ensure a cleaner taste in your dish.

  2. Chop vegetables: Wash and chop your fresh kale, tomatoes, and scallions. Aim for bite-sized pieces to ensure even cooking and a pleasing presentation.

  3. Sauté greens: Heat olive oil in a nonstick pan over medium-high heat. Add chopped kale and scallions, sautéing for about 2 minutes until they soften slightly and turn vibrant green.

  4. Combine flavors: Stir in the chopped tomatoes, minced garlic, chili powder, and rinsed chickpeas. Cover the pan, allowing it to cook for another 2 minutes until everything is heated through.

  5. Finish with toppings: Add parsley, olives, jalapeños, and crumbled feta cheese to the pan. Cook for 1-2 additional minutes until the feta has softened and melded into the dish.

  6. Serve warm: Spoon the colorful mixture onto plates and enjoy your One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ner, optionally topped with fresh herbs or a handful of arugula for an added touch.

Optional: Drizzle with olive oil and a squeeze of lemon juice for extra zest!

Expert Tips for One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ner

Rinse for freshness: Rinse chickpeas and feta cheese to reduce saltiness; this enhances their flavor and allows other ingredients to shine.

Texture matters: Avoid overcooking vegetables to maintain that perfect tender-crisp texture; this keeps your dish vibrant and visually appealing.

Customize your spice: Adjust jalapeños and chili powder to your heat preference; start with less if you’re unsure and add more as desired.

Herb alternatives: Experiment with fresh herbs like cilantro or oregano based on your taste; they can brighten up your One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ner beautifully.

Sprinkle for crunch: For added texture, top with seeds or avocado when serving; this creates a delightful contrast to the soft chickpeas and veggies.

How to Store and Freeze One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ner

Fridge: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. This ensures the flavors stay fresh while keeping your meal ready to enjoy anytime.

Freezer: To freeze, portion into freezer-safe containers and store for up to 3 months. Make sure to let it cool completely before sealing to prevent ice crystals.

Reheating: Reheat meal on the stove over medium heat, adding a splash of water to revive the moisture. You can also microwave until heated through, approximately 2-3 minutes.

One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ner in 15 Minutes

One-Pan Mediterranean Chickpea Dinner is quick and tasty, perfect for busy nights.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Mediterranean
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Base
  • 1 can Canned Chickpeas drained and rinsed
  • 2 cups Fresh Kale chopped
  • 1 cup Tomatoes chopped
For the Flavor
  • 1 cup Feta Cheese crumbled
  • 3 cloves Garlic minced
  • 2 scallions Scallions chopped
  • 1 tbsp Parsley chopped
  • 1 tbsp Basil chopped
For the Spice
  • 1 tsp Chili Powder
  • 1 jalapeño Jalapeños pickled or fresh
For the Finish
  • 1/2 cup Olives Kalamata, pitted

Equipment

  • nonstick pan

Method
 

How to Make
  1. Drain and rinse the canned chickpeas under cold water to remove excess sodium.
  2. Wash and chop your fresh kale, tomatoes, and scallions into bite-sized pieces.
  3. Heat olive oil in a nonstick pan over medium-high heat. Add chopped kale and scallions, sauté for about 2 minutes.
  4. Stir in the chopped tomatoes, minced garlic, chili powder, and rinsed chickpeas. Cover the pan and cook for another 2 minutes.
  5. Add parsley, olives, jalapeños, and crumbled feta cheese. Cook for 1-2 additional minutes.
  6. Spoon the mixture onto plates and enjoy your dinner, optionally topped with fresh herbs.

Nutrition

Serving: 1servingCalories: 350kcalCarbohydrates: 40gProtein: 15gFat: 18gSaturated Fat: 5gPolyunsaturated Fat: 2gMonounsaturated Fat: 8gCholesterol: 25mgSodium: 600mgPotassium: 600mgFiber: 10gSugar: 5gVitamin A: 1500IUVitamin C: 25mgCalcium: 200mgIron: 4mg
